Time-Based vs. Criterion-Based Evaluations

Time-focused protocols rely on fixed healing periods – like 6 months post-ACL reconstruction. However, a 2024 study found 38% of athletes cleared this way failed functional tests. Criterion-based methods use measurable targets:

Factor Time-Based Criterion-Based
Quad Strength 90 days minimum 90% limb symmetry
Plyometric Capacity Not assessed Single-leg hop ≥80% pre-injury
Re-Injury Rate* 22% 9%

*Data from 2023 meta-analysis of 1,200 cases

Hop Testing and Limb Symmetry Indices

Single-leg hop tests reveal hidden imbalances that could jeopardize recovery. Athletes must achieve ≥90% symmetry between limbs for clearance – a benchmark supported by 2024 studies on ACL rehabilitation. Our Calgary clinic uses three variations:

  • Forward hop for distance
  • Triple hop endurance assessment
  • Cross-over hop for lateral stability

Isokinetic Dynamometry and Strength Ratios

Computer-assisted strength testing provides precise hamstring-to-quadriceps ratios critical for ligament protection. Optimal ratios vary by sport:

Sport Target H:Q Ratio Testing Speed (deg/sec)
Hockey 80-85% 180
Soccer 75-80% 300
Skiing 70-75% 60

Acute vs. Chronic Workload Strategies

Acute workload measures short-term activity spikes, while chronic tracks 4-week averages. Maintaining a 0.8-1.3 ratio between these metrics reduces injury risks by 41%. Calgary hockey players using this balance saw 28% faster recovery timelines.
